Oracle AIX系统文件备份指南
oracle aix备份 文件

首页 2025-05-28 17:23:52



Oracle AIX环境下的高效备份策略与实践 在高度信息化和数据驱动的时代,数据的安全性与可用性已成为企业运营的核心要素之一

    对于运行Oracle数据库的系统管理员而言,确保数据的安全不仅意味着防止外部攻击和数据泄露,还涵盖了日常的数据备份与恢复策略

    特别是在AIX(Advanced Interactive Executive)操作系统环境下,Oracle数据库的备份工作显得尤为重要且复杂

    本文将深入探讨Oracle AIX备份文件的最佳实践,旨在为企业提供一个全面、高效且可靠的备份解决方案

     一、Oracle AIX备份的重要性 AIX作为IBM Power Systems系列服务器的主要操作系统,以其强大的稳定性和高性能著称,广泛应用于关键业务系统中

    Oracle数据库,作为业界领先的关系型数据库管理系统,与AIX的结合为企业提供了强大的数据处理能力

    然而,任何系统都无法完全避免硬件故障、人为错误或自然灾害等潜在风险,因此,定期且有效的数据备份成为了保障业务连续性的关键措施

     有效的Oracle AIX备份不仅能够确保数据在灾难发生时能够迅速恢复,减少业务中断时间,还能帮助企业遵守行业法规和数据保护政策,避免因数据丢失或损坏导致的法律纠纷和财务损失

    此外,备份数据还可以用于测试环境搭建、历史数据分析等非生产用途,进一步提升企业的运营效率和决策准确性

     二、Oracle AIX备份的基本方法 Oracle数据库提供了多种备份方式,包括物理备份(冷备份、热备份)、逻辑备份(使用RMAN、exp/imp工具)以及快照备份等

    在AIX环境下,结合操作系统的特性,选择合适的备份方法至关重要

     2.1 冷备份 冷备份是在数据库关闭状态下进行的物理文件拷贝

    由于不涉及数据库活动事务的处理,冷备份相对简单且快速,但会导致服务中断,不适用于24/7运行的关键业务系统

    在AIX上执行冷备份时,需确保文件系统处于一致状态,并考虑使用`tar`、`cpio`等命令进行文件复制

     2.2 热备份 热备份允许在数据库运行期间进行备份,利用Oracle的归档日志机制保证数据一致性

    在AIX环境下,热备份通常通过RMAN(Recovery Manager)工具实现,它提供了自动化、灵活的备份策略配置,支持增量备份、差异备份等多种模式,有效减少备份时间和存储空间占用

     2.3逻辑备份 逻辑备份通过导出数据库的结构和数据到文件形式进行,适用于小规模数据库或特定数据对象的备份

    Oracle的`exp`(Export)和`imp`(Import)工具是早期的逻辑备份解决方案,而`expdp`(Data Pump Export)和`impdp`(Data Pump Import)则提供了更快、更灵活的数据迁移和备份能力

    在AIX系统上,这些工具可以配合cron作业实现定期自动化备份

     2.4 快照备份 利用AIX的文件系统快照功能,可以在不中断数据库服务的情况下创建数据的一致性视图,适用于需要频繁备份且对性能影响敏感的场景

    结合Oracle的闪回技术,快照备份能够进一步提升恢复效率和灵活性

     三、实施高效备份策略的关键要素 3.1 制定备份计划 根据业务需求和数据变化频率,制定合理的备份计划是基础

    应考虑备份窗口、备份类型(全量/增量/差异)、备份频率(每日/每周/每月)以及备份存储位置等因素

    在AIX上,可以利用cron服务安排定时任务,确保备份作业按计划执行

     3.2 优化备份性能 备份作业对系统资源有一定的消耗,特别是在大规模数据库备份时

    通过调整RMAN参数(如并行度、缓冲区大小)、使用高速存储设备、优化网络带宽等方式,可以有效提升备份速度,减少对生产环境的影响

     3.3 数据验证与恢复演练 备份数据的完整性和可恢复性是检验备份策略有效性的关键

    定期执行数据验证(如检查备份文件的校验和、尝试部分恢复测试)和完整的恢复演练,能够及时发现并纠正备份过程中的问题,确保在真正需要时能够快速、准确地恢复数据

     3.4 安全存储与管理 备份数据应存储在安全、可靠的位置,如磁带库、远程存储系统或云存储服务

    同时,实施严格的访问控制和加密措施,防止数据泄露

    在AIX环境中,可以考虑使用AIX的内置安全特性,如文件系统权限、加密服务等,增强备份数据的安全性

     3.5自动化与监控 自动化备份作业可以减少人为错误,提高备份效率

    通过RMAN脚本、Shell脚本结合cron作业,可以实现备份任务的自动化调度

    同时,建立备份作业的监控机制,实时跟踪备份进度、检测异常状态,确保备份过程的可控性和透明度

     四、未来趋势与挑战 随着云计算、大数据、人工智能等技术的快速发展,Oracle AIX备份策略也面临着新的挑战和机遇

    一方面,云备份解决方案以其弹性扩展、高可用性、成本效益等优势,逐渐成为企业备份策略的重要组成部分;另一方面,数据量的爆炸式增长对数据备份的效率、存储成本以及长期保留策略提出了更高要求

     因此,未来Oracle AIX环境下的备份策略需要更加注重技术创新与融合,如采用更高效的压缩算法、智能备份优化技术、云原生备份解决方案等,以适应不断变化的数据保护需求

    同时,加强备份数据的智能分析与管理,利用机器学习等技术提升备份恢复的效率与准确性,将是企业数据保护领域的重要发展方向

     结语 Oracle AIX环境下的数据备份是一项系统工程,涉及备份方法的选择、策略的制定、性能的优化、安全的保障以及未来的适应性规划

    通过实施科学合理的备份策略,企业不仅能够有效应对各种数据风险,还能为业务的持续发展和创新提供坚实的数据支撑

    在这个数据为王的时代,让我们携手共进,构建更加安全、高效、智能的数据备份体系,为企业的发展保驾护航

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道